1. Exam Structure and Assessment Objectives | 考试结构与评估目标

The AQA A-level Sociology qualification is linear, with three 2‑hour papers sat at the end of Year 13. Paper 1 covers Education with Theory and Methods, Paper 2 covers Topics in Sociology (typically Families and Households plus Beliefs in Society or the Stratification option), and Paper 3 covers Crime and Deviance with Theory and Methods. Each paper carries 80 marks and is worth 33.3% of the A‑level. Understanding the weighting of Assessment Objectives (AOs) is crucial: AO1 (knowledge and understanding) accounts for about 44% of the total marks, AO2 (application) for about 32%, and AO3 (analysis and evaluation) for about 24%. Past papers consistently test these AOs by mixing short‑answer definitions, ‘outline and explain’ items, and extended essay questions that demand sustained evaluation.

2. Education: Recurring Themes and Question Types | 教育:反复出现的主题与题型

In Paper 1, Education questions draw on classical sociological explanations (functionalism, Marxism, interactionism) and contemporary policies. A typical 4-mark ‘outline two’ question might ask: “Outline two ways in which marketisation policies have affected educational achievement.” Past papers show that successful answers clearly name the policy (e.g., league tables, formula funding) and link it to a specific effect, such as increased competition or cream‑skimming. The 6‑mark ‘outline three’ questions require concise paragraphs that identify and briefly explain a function or reason, often from a named perspective. The 10‑mark ‘outline and explain’ item demands two developed paragraphs using sociological evidence, while the 30‑mark essay requires a sustained argument that balances different theoretical viewpoints and engages with contemporary research. Examiner reports consistently highlight the need to go beyond description and to use specific studies, such as Ball’s work on setting and streaming or Gewirtz’s analysis of parental choice.

3. Families and Households: Linking Theory to Contemporary Debates | 家庭与住户:将理论与当代争论相联系

The Families and Households topic is assessed in Paper 2. Past questions frequently ask candidates to examine reasons for changes in family structures, the diversity of contemporary families, and the impact of social policies. A common 20‑mark essay question is: “Evaluate the view that the family is losing its functions.” Top‑scoring answers avoid a simple ‘agree or disagree’ structure. Instead, they evaluate functionalist claims of primary socialisation and stabilisation against postmodernist and feminist critiques, referencing changes such as the rise of dual‑earner households, divorce rates, and the privatised nuclear family. They also bring in evidence from the Rapoports’ five types of family diversity and Chester’s neo‑conventional family. The 10‑mark ‘outline and explain two’ questions often target demographic trends, such as the decline in marriage or the increase in cohabitation, requiring precise reference to statistical data and sociological explanations like secularisation or changing gender roles.

4. Crime and Deviance: Mastering Theoretical and Practical Debates | 犯罪与越轨:掌握理论性与实务性争论

Paper 3 devotes significant space to Crime and Deviance. Past papers reveal a strong emphasis on explaining patterns of offending by class, gender, and ethnicity, as well as theoretical perspectives on the causes of crime. A classic 30‑mark question is: “Evaluate sociological explanations of female crime.” Successful answers integrate functionalist sex‑role theory, Heidensohn’s control theory, and Adler’s liberation thesis, before contrasting them with more recent feminist analyses and intersectional approaches. Crucially, candidates must evaluate each theory rather than merely describe it, using evidence on the gender gap in recorded crime, victimisation surveys, and the criminalisation of women. The 10‑mark ‘outline and explain two’ items often ask why some ethnic groups are over‑represented in the criminal justice system, requiring a nuanced use of statistics, labelling theory, and left‑realist explanations of relative deprivation and marginalisation. Examiner reports caution against relying on outdated or oversimplified data and stress the importance of recognising the social construction of crime statistics.

5. Theory and Methods: The Golden Thread Across All Papers | 理论与方法:贯穿所有试卷的金线

Theory and Methods is assessed in Papers 1 and 3, but its principles are essential for all questions. Past paper questions explicitly require evaluation of the usefulness of positivist versus interpretivist approaches, the relationships between theory and methods, and the role of values in sociology. A typical 10‑mark question in the Methods in Context section (Paper 1) asks: “Applying material from Item A, analyse two advantages of using covert participant observation to investigate the workings of a school.” Strong answers link the method precisely to the specific educational context, discussing access, validity, and ethical issues raised by the item. The 20‑mark theory essays (e.g., “Evaluate the view that sociology cannot be a science”) reward candidates who structure their arguments around ontology, epistemology, and the contributions of key theorists such as Durkheim, Popper, Kuhn, and postmodernists. Examiner feedback repeatedly indicates that candidates need to move beyond textbook summaries and show independent engagement with methodological debates.

6. Social Stratification and Differentiation (Optional Topic) | 社会分层与差异(选修主题)

Where Stratification and Differentiation is chosen instead of Beliefs in Society, past papers focus on class, gender, ethnicity, and age as systems of stratification. A commonly tested 30‑mark question is: “Evaluate the view that social class is no longer the most important source of identity in contemporary society.” High‑scoring essays weigh Marxian and Weberian class analysis against postmodern theories that emphasise identity as fluid and no longer tied to occupation or wealth. They incorporate evidence on the gig economy, cultural omnivorousness, and the work of Savage on the ‘new rich’ and ‘precariat’. The 10‑mark ‘outline and explain two’ items often probe the causes of gender pay differentials or ethnic inequality, demanding precise references to horizontal and vertical segregation, patriarchal ideology, and statistical data from the ONS. Examiner reports underline the importance of not conflating stratification with simple inequality but instead discussing the structured nature of social hierarchies and their reproduction.

7. Decoding the Mark Schemes: What Counts as Evaluation? | 破解评分方案:什么才算评价?

A consistent message from AQA mark schemes is that evaluation is not a token final paragraph but must be woven throughout the essay. For Band 4 (top marks), answers must demonstrate ‘sustained analysis and evaluation’. In practice, this means regularly asking ‘how useful is this explanation?’, ‘to what extent does the evidence support it?’, and ‘what are the limitations of this study?’. When a question asks to evaluate the contribution of functionalism to our understanding of crime, a high‑level answer will not only state Durkheim’s concept of anomie and collective conscience but also weigh it against strain theory, subcultural theory, and Marxist criticisms that functionalism ignores power and class conflict. The use of evaluative phrases – ‘however’, ‘in contrast’, ‘this is supported by… but challenged by…’ – signals to examiners that critical thinking is taking place. Past examiner reports repeatedly complain of ‘excessive description’ and ‘lack of evaluation’, so practising the integration of evaluation points is essential.

8. Using Contemporary Evidence and Synoptic Links | 运用当代证据与贯通性联系

Since the 2015 specification reform, AQA has required answers to be synoptic, drawing on knowledge from across the course. For example, a Crime and Deviance essay can be enriched by linking to educational labelling theory or family breakdown. Past papers show that top‑scoring students do not treat topics in isolation. When discussing the causes of gang membership, they may connect to Willis’s ‘lads’ counter‑school culture in Education, or to the crisis of masculinity explored in Families and Households. Moreover, using contemporary evidence – such as ONS crime statistics from 2023, the impact of the cost‑of‑living crisis on crime patterns, or recent policy changes like the Police, Crime, Sentencing and Courts Act 2022 – demonstrates engagement with the real world and lifts answers above textbook generalities. Examiner reports praise answers that are ‘up‑to‑date’ and show ‘application to contemporary society’.

9. Common Mistakes Highlighted by Examiner Reports | 考官报告指出的常见错误

Analysing multiple examiner reports reveals a set of repeating errors. First, candidates often misread the question, answering on a related but different topic; for example, writing about the functions of crime when the question asks about the causes of crime. Second, many answers list studies without explaining their relevance or evaluating their strengths and weaknesses. A string of researcher names and dates is not enough unless each piece of evidence is deployed in service of an argument. Third, time management is a major failing: candidates spend too long on low‑mark questions, leaving insufficient time for the 30‑mark essays. Fourth, some answers ignore the Item provided, especially in the Methods in Context question, losing the opportunity to demonstrate application (AO2). Fifth, conceptual precision is often weak – terms like ‘value consensus’, ‘patriarchy’, and ‘globalisation’ are used loosely, which undermines academic credibility. Practising with past papers under timed conditions and using mark schemes to self‑assess can help overcome these pitfalls.

10. Essay Construction: Planning and Structure | 建构论述题:规划与结构

The 30‑mark essays in all three papers demand a clear, logical structure. A highly effective technique is to spend the first 3‑5 minutes planning a skeleton that maps out an introduction, 4‑5 main paragraphs, and a conclusion. Each main paragraph should open with a point that directly addresses the question, state and explain relevant theory or evidence, and then evaluate that material. For instance, in answering “Evaluate the view that society is becoming more individualised,” a strong paragraph might begin: “Beck’s individualisation thesis argues that traditional structures such as class and family have lost their hold, meaning individuals must now construct their own biographies. This is supported by the rise in self‑employment and the decline of lifetime employment. However, structural constraints remain; the richest 10% still own over 50% of wealth, suggesting class‑based inequalities persist.” The conclusion should not just repeat points but should offer a weighted judgement, perhaps arguing that individualisation is a partial trend, fragmented by enduring structural inequalities. Practising this structure using past paper questions builds the mental muscle memory required for the exam.

11. The Value of Feedback and Self‑Assessment | 反馈与自我评估的价值

One of the most powerful revision strategies is to complete past paper questions under timed conditions and then compare your answer against the indicative content in the mark scheme. Pay particular attention to the ‘indicative content’ section, which lists the points and studies an examiner might expect. However, avoid treating it as a definitive mark scheme; examiners are instructed to reward any valid sociological material. After self‑assessment, rewrite a paragraph or two incorporating the feedback, focusing on improving evaluation or using more precise evidence. Some successful students keep a ‘mistake log’ where they document common errors – for example, confusing qualitative and quantitative data, or misattributing a theory to the wrong sociologist. This reflective process helps to internalise the standards expected and builds the confidence needed to tackle unfamiliar questions.

12. Final Preparation and Exam‑Day Strategy | 最后准备与考试日策略

In the weeks before the exam, shift your focus from content review to active retrieval and timed practice. Use flashcards to memorise key studies and theories, but always link them to the question stems they might address. On exam day, read the entire paper before you start writing, marking the questions you feel most confident about. Stick rigidly to the mark allocation: spend no more than 5 minutes on a 4‑mark question, 15 minutes on a 10‑mark ‘outline and explain two’, and around 40 minutes on a 30‑mark essay. For the Methods in Context question, underline the specific research context in the Item and continuously refer back to it. Remember that sociology is an evidence‑based discipline, so every claim you make – whether theoretical or empirical – must be substantiated.
